Just the thing for when those courgettes get carried away and look more like marrows.

If the spices seem daunting, substitute a tablespoon of curry powder.
Spicy Courgette Chutney
Ingredients
- 1 kg Courgette chopped
- 2 teaspoons turmeric
- 1 teaspoon sea salt
- 2 cups white vinegar
- 1 cup sultanas
- 2 tomatoes chopped
- 1½ cups sugar
- 1 large onion finely chopped
- 4 garlic cloves crushed
- 1 tablespoon grated ginger
- 1 tablespoon cumin
- 1 tablespoon ground coriander
- 1 cinnamon stick
- ¼ teaspoon chilli flakes (optional)
- 1 teaspoon salt
Instructions

Place courgette in a large bowl and sprinkle with turmeric and salt; allow to sit for at least 2 hours, stirring once or twice. Drain off the excess liquid.

Place all ingredients into a large heavy based pan. Heat while stirring until all the sugar is dissolved, reduce heat to very low and simmer until mixture softens and thickens.

Pour into sterilised jars and store.
